An Opportunity to View DVDs of Australian Films in the Library

  • Date Jul 15, 2010
An Opportunity to View DVDs of Australian Films in the Library The Korea Foundation Cultural Center is pleased to announce five new acquisitions of Australian Films for the library’s DVD collection, kindly donated by Dr. Brian Yecies, who was a Korea Foundation Fellowship recipient in 2005 and is now a researcher at the Asia-Pacific Center, University of Wollongong, Australia. These donated DVDs include four DVDs of representative Australian films and one DVD of students’ films of the International Film School Sydney. Dr. Yecies is working hard to introduce Korean films to Australian society. 1. Balibo (2009/War, Thriller) 2. He Died with a Felafel in His Hand (2001/Thriller) 3. Oyster Farmer (2004/Romance) 4. The Adventures of Priscilla, Queen of the Desert (2009/Drama, Musical) 5. International Film School Sydney (2009/Various - 2009 Student Films) The detailed information of movies is attached.
